A concise, compelling statement at the beginning of a resume for housekeeping positions serves to highlight relevant skills and experience, showcasing a candidate’s suitability for the role. For example, a statement might emphasize experience with specialized cleaning techniques, commitment to maintaining high sanitation standards, or the ability to work efficiently and independently. This targeted summary allows potential employers to quickly assess a candidate’s qualifications and determine their fit for the available position.
This introductory statement provides several key advantages. It enables hiring managers to efficiently identify candidates who possess the necessary skills and experience, streamlining the hiring process. Furthermore, it allows applicants to clearly articulate their career goals and demonstrate their understanding of the specific requirements of a housekeeping role. While traditionally a standard resume component, its prevalence has shifted over time, with some career experts now recommending its inclusion only in specific circumstances, such as when targeting a niche housekeeping role or possessing highly specialized skills.

1. Target specific roles.
Targeting specific roles within the housekeeping field constitutes a crucial element of a well-crafted resume objective. A generic objective lacks the precision necessary to capture the attention of hiring managers seeking candidates with specialized skills or experience. Specificity demonstrates a clear understanding of the job requirements and a genuine interest in the particular position. For instance, an objective stating a desire for a “housekeeping position in a fast-paced hotel environment” is less effective than one expressing interest in a “Room Attendant position at a luxury hotel, contributing to exceptional guest experiences through meticulous room preparation and maintenance.” The latter demonstrates a targeted focus and aligns the candidate’s skills with the specific demands of the role.
This targeted approach yields several benefits. It allows applicant tracking systems (ATS) to efficiently filter resumes based on keywords related to specific roles, increasing the likelihood of a resume reaching human resources. Furthermore, it enables hiring managers to quickly identify candidates whose career aspirations align with the available positions, saving valuable time during the recruitment process. Consider a candidate applying for a housekeeping role within a healthcare facility. An objective tailored to this environment, mentioning experience with infection control protocols or handling hazardous materials, immediately distinguishes the applicant from those with generalized housekeeping experience. This targeted approach demonstrates professional focus and increases the chances of securing an interview.

5. Quantify achievements.
Quantifying achievements within the objective statement of a housekeeping resume provides concrete evidence of a candidate’s capabilities and impact. Rather than simply listing responsibilities, quantifiable metrics demonstrate the value a candidate brought to previous roles, strengthening their credibility and showcasing their contributions. This data-driven approach provides hiring managers with tangible evidence of a candidate’s effectiveness, allowing for a more objective assessment of their qualifications.
-
Improved Efficiency:
Quantifying improvements in efficiency provides a clear measure of a candidate’s impact. For instance, stating “Streamlined cleaning processes, resulting in a 15% reduction in turnaround time between guest checkouts” demonstrates a significant contribution to operational efficiency. This data-driven approach provides concrete evidence of a candidate’s ability to optimize processes and improve productivity within a housekeeping setting.
-
Enhanced Quality:
Metrics related to quality improvements showcase a candidate’s commitment to maintaining high standards. An example such as “Maintained a 98% guest satisfaction rating for room cleanliness over a two-year period” demonstrates a consistent dedication to exceeding expectations and providing exceptional service. This quantifiable achievement provides concrete evidence of a candidate’s ability to consistently deliver high-quality results.
-
Cost Reduction:
Quantifying cost-saving initiatives demonstrates a candidate’s ability to contribute to the financial well-being of an organization. Stating “Reduced cleaning supply expenses by 10% through efficient inventory management practices” highlights a candidate’s resourcefulness and cost-consciousness. This quantifiable achievement showcases a candidate’s value beyond their core responsibilities.
-
Safety Improvements:
Metrics related to safety improvements highlight a candidate’s commitment to maintaining a safe working environment. An example like “Reduced workplace accidents by 20% through the implementation of enhanced safety protocols” demonstrates a proactive approach to safety and a commitment to mitigating risks. This quantifiable achievement showcases a candidate’s contribution to a safe and productive work environment.

6. Maintain conciseness.
Maintaining conciseness in a housekeeping resume objective proves crucial for maximizing impact. Hiring managers often review numerous applications, dedicating limited time to each. A concise objective statement ensures key qualifications are readily apparent, capturing attention and facilitating efficient evaluation. Brevity demonstrates respect for the reader’s time and conveys professionalism. An unnecessarily lengthy objective risks losing the reader’s interest and obscuring essential information. For example, “Seeking a challenging housekeeping role in a fast-paced environment to utilize strong cleaning skills and contribute to maintaining impeccable hygiene standards” can be more effectively condensed to “Experienced housekeeper seeking a fast-paced environment to maintain high hygiene standards.” This concise version retains essential information while significantly reducing word count.

Frequently Asked Questions
The following addresses common inquiries regarding the inclusion and crafting of objective statements within housekeeping resumes.
Question 1: Are objective statements still relevant in contemporary resumes?
While their necessity is debated, a well-crafted objective can benefit specific candidates, such as career changers, those targeting niche roles, or individuals with limited experience. It allows them to highlight transferable skills and demonstrate a clear career focus.
Question 2: How does an objective differ from a summary statement?
An objective focuses on career goals and what the candidate hopes to achieve in a role. A summary statement highlights key skills and experience relevant to the target position.
Question 3: What are common mistakes to avoid when writing a housekeeping resume objective?
Common pitfalls include generic statements, excessive length, and focusing on personal needs rather than employer benefits. Objectives should be specific, concise, and highlight value offered to the prospective employer.
Question 4: How can an objective statement be tailored to specific housekeeping roles?
Researching the target role and incorporating relevant keywords and skills demonstrates understanding of the position’s requirements. Mentioning specific certifications or experience related to the role further enhances tailoring.
Question 5: How can quantifiable achievements be incorporated into an objective?
Instead of simply listing responsibilities, quantify accomplishments using metrics. For example, “Reduced cleaning supply waste by 15% through improved inventory management” demonstrates tangible impact.
Question 6: Is it necessary to include an objective if the resume includes a detailed work history section?
While not always mandatory, an objective can still provide a concise overview of career goals and highlight key qualifications, even with a comprehensive work history.

Tips for Crafting Effective Housekeeping Resume Objectives
A well-defined objective statement can significantly enhance a housekeeping resume. The following tips provide guidance for crafting impactful objectives tailored to specific roles and showcasing relevant qualifications.
Tip 1: Prioritize Specificity: Avoid generic statements. Tailor the objective to the specific housekeeping role, mentioning the desired position title and the type of establishment. For example, instead of “Seeking a housekeeping position,” consider “Seeking a Room Attendant position at a five-star hotel.”
Tip 2: Showcase Relevant Skills: Highlight key skills directly relevant to the target role, using keywords from the job description. Emphasize skills such as deep cleaning, sanitation procedures, linen management, or guest relations.
Tip 3: Quantify Achievements: Whenever possible, quantify accomplishments using metrics to demonstrate impact. For instance, “Reduced cleaning supply waste by 10% through efficient inventory management” adds concrete value to the statement.
Tip 4: Demonstrate Experience: Briefly mention relevant experience, even if entry-level, to demonstrate practical application of skills. Example: “Seeking a Housekeeping Supervisor role, leveraging two years of experience in team leadership and quality control.”
Tip 5: Express Enthusiasm: Convey genuine interest and passion for the profession. Phrases like “Dedicated to maintaining impeccable cleanliness standards” or “Committed to providing exceptional guest experiences” add a positive tone.
Tip 6: Maintain Brevity: Keep the objective concise and focused. Avoid lengthy paragraphs and prioritize clarity. Aim for a brief, impactful statement that quickly conveys key qualifications.
Tip 7: Proofread Carefully: Errors in grammar and spelling detract from professionalism. Thoroughly proofread the objective statement to ensure accuracy and clarity.
